2023 BSS® Recipients

Congratulations to the following members that obtained their designation in 2023
Louay Saleem Alalawi

Louay Saleem Alalawi, BSc. And MSc. Degree in the Architectural Engineering field. Practiced Architectural design, Construction Management and Building Envelope design within many international consultancy firms in the Gulf region for more than 15 years. Worked within the curtain wall industry in Ontario, Canada since 2017, as a curtain wall designer, design manager and Sr. job captain, involved in curtain wall design; producing the installation details, ensuring the implementation of building science principles, in addition to supervising the curtain wall frames fabrication and installation methods / strategies.

Jelena Madzarevic

Jelena is a Building and Material Sciences Specialist with EllisDon. Her focus is to support project teams with navigating technical challenges and envelope-related risks across Canada. Her approach is to combine sound building science principles with the complex reality of construction. This includes informing technical decisions during the early project phases, tendering of envelope scopes and site planning (sequencing, mockups etc.).She also supports company-wide development by delivering building science training and technical guidelines. Jelena has a Master’s in Building Science from Toronto Metropolitan University and is a Certified Passive House Consultant (PHIUS) and Building Science Specialist (BSS). 

Sydney Van Bakel

Sydney Van Bakel is a graduate of the Architectural Conservation and Sustainability Engineering Program at Carleton University and joined the Building Science Department at Cleland Jardine Engineering Ltd. in 2021. Sydney has worked on a variety of building envelope restoration projects, providing design, contract administration and field review services. In addition, she regularly participated in visual investigations and destructive testing within cladding systems to diagnose building envelope problems across the commercial, institutional, and residential sectors.
